A conventional noodle soup may very well be extra detrimental to your well being than initially believed, based on a current longevity research.
Actually, ramen, which is a scrumptious, warming Japanese concoction made up of noodles and scorching broth, has been discovered to extend the chance of a untimely demise, analysis has proven.
Revealed within the Journal of Diet, Well being and Ageing, the scientists assessed greater than 6,500 contributors throughout the Yamagata area in Japan to uncover the influence of the tasty broth on life expectancy.
The vast majority of those that took half within the research ate the Japanese dish a minimum of as soon as a month, whereas one in three would devour ramen each week.

The entire contributors have been sectioned up based on how steadily they consumed a bowl of ramen: lower than as soon as a month, one to a few occasions a month, a few times per week, and three or extra occasions per week.
From the info, the research revealed that those that sat down for a bowl of ramen extra steadily have been extra prone to be youthful males who have been chubby, drank alcohol and smoked.
Moreover, comorbidities have been discovered to be way more prone to happen. This could embrace persistent circumstances equivalent to diabetes or hypertension.

From the numbers, those that drank a minimum of half of the broth and consumed the noodle soup typically elevated their probability of an early demise.
Though ramen may appear notably handy and wholesome at first look being packed stuffed with leafy greens and protein, the broth is definitely the place a few of the risks lie.
“Objectively speaking, instant ramen noodles may not be the most nutritious option out there. They can be very high in sodium and may not contain much in the way of fibre, whole grains, vitamins or minerals,” dietician Cara Harbstreet, founding father of Road Good Diet, advised EatingWell.
“However, as with any food, it’s important to look at the bigger picture because no single food will convey a health benefit or health risk by eating it.”

Nonetheless, Ms Harstreet warned that packaged noodles typically rely “heavily” on sodium for flavour.
Excessive sodium consumption is linked very intently with hypertension, which might drive danger of stroke and heart problems.
With a view to make ramen more healthy, lowering the sodium content material is essential. The dietician really helpful merely utilizing much less of the flavour packet, or serving the dish with much less broth.
Or, if in case you have the time, making the broth and seasoning from scratch may show to be price it – each well being and flavour-wise.
